Job description

Therapeutic Educational Practitioner • Daily Rate: £110 - £125 • Location: East London • Job Type: Full-time We are seeking a dedicated Therapeutic Educational Practitioner to join our team, working with children who exhibit challenging behaviours. This role is ideal for individuals who are passionate about making a positive impact in the lives of young people. A background in sports can be advantageous but is not essential. Day-to-day of the role: • Implement educational and therapeutic interventions to support children with challenging behaviours. • Develop and maintain strong, supportive relationships with children, helping them to achieve their educational and personal goals. • Utilise a variety of strategies tailored to individual needs to promote positive behaviour and engagement. • Collaborate with other professionals such as teachers, therapists, and family members to plan and coordinate effective support. • Monitor and record children's progress, adapting strategies as needed to optimise outcomes. • Participate in training and development opportunities to enhance your skills and knowledge in therapeutic education. Required Skills & Qualifications: • Experience working with children, particularly those who exhibit challenging behaviours. • Strong interpersonal and communication skills. • Ability to work independently and as part of a team. • Resilient and patient, with a compassionate approach. • Background in sports is beneficial but not mandatory. Benefits: • Competitive daily rate. • Opportunities for professional development and training. • Supportive and collaborative working environment. • Satisfaction of making a significant difference in children’s lives.
